The Lighthouse Keeper's Lunch - The Lighthouse Keeper Stories
Ronda Armitage

Rediscover your favourite Lighthouse Keeper picture book! Once there was a lighthouse keeper called Mr Grinling...
Mr Grinling LOVES his food, especially the scrumptious lunch Mrs Grinling sends him every day. But - oh no! - he's not the only one who likes a snack and the local seagulls have started stealing Mrs Grinling's tasty treats...! Can Mr and Mrs Grinling come up with a cunning plan to keep those pesky seagulls away?
Adventure, thrills and laughter on every page making it great fun for the whole family and for old and new fans of the series. Timeless story that generations of children have enjoyed. Lush illustrations that echo the warmth, fun and humour of the book.
Wonder: The Natural History Museum Poetry Book
Ana Sampson

Wonder: The Natural History Museum Poetry Book by Ana Sampson is a beautiful collection of poetry with poems inspired by The Natural History Museum.
Covering everything from the depths of space to the centre of the earth, this beautiful collection includes poems about the solar system, planet earth, oceans and rivers, birds, dinosaurs, fossils, wildlife, flowers, fungi, insects, explorers and palaeontologists. Each section includes an introduction to the topic with insights into particularly interesting species.
The museum has a collection of over eighty million objects and, behind the scenes of its twenty-eight galleries, it holds kilometres of preserved specimens, libraries of rare books and artworks, wonders gathered on some of the most famous voyages in history, rooms packed with pressed plants, warehouses teeming with stuffed animals and freezers full of DNA. As well as a museum, it is a state-of-the-art centre for discovery with over three hundred resident scientists and over ten thousand visiting researchers each year, investigating everything from dinosaurs to life on other planets.
This collection is made up of brand new and classic poems, illustrated with botanical drawings and engravings from the museum’s collections.
This fantastic collection speaks of the wonder of nature and shows us why we need to look after our incredible planet.
